The 9 Simple Steps Of Christian Financial Stewardship (Which Step Are You On?)

woman with credit card in wallet

Christian Financial Stewardships

I’ve been studying the Proverbs 31 woman a lot lately and based on what I’ve read, becoming financially free would be one of her life goals. (you know because I’m sure she thought about life goals in those exact terms ).

As I mentioned in this post, P31 had an entrepreneurial spirit and engaged in godly financial stewardship.

She was buying property, making money from the property and then reinvesting that money by planting a vineyard.

Then she sewed sashes and sold them to the merchants.

She also gave money to the needy which is a huge but sometimes overlooked component of financial stewardship.

She definitely doesn’t seem like she lacked what she needed for her family, servants, and herself. Continue reading
